ieee802154: ca8210: Add missing check for kfifo_alloc() in ca8210_probe()
[ Upstream commit 2c87309ea741341c6722efdf1fb3f50dd427c823 ]
ca8210_test_interface_init() returns the result of kfifo_alloc(),
which can be non-zero in case of an error. The caller, ca8210_probe(),
should check the return value and do error-handling if it fails.
Fixes: ded845a781
("ieee802154: Add CA8210 IEEE 802.15.4 device driver")
